Zelda: Ocarina of Time Remake: A Timeless Classic Reborn

Perhaps the most exciting revelation is the impending remake of The Legend of Zelda: Ocarina of Time. This critically acclaimed title, originally released in 1998, is considered by many to be one of the greatest video games of all time. A full-scale remake, built specifically for the Switch 2’s enhanced hardware, promises to deliver a breathtaking reimagining of Hyrule. The Universal first reported on the remake’s development, solidifying its status as a near certainty.

Star Fox Takes Flight Again

After a prolonged period of dormancy, the Star Fox franchise is poised for a triumphant return. Reports suggest a brand new Star Fox game is slated for release this summer on the Switch 2, with an announcement expected as early as this month. Nintendo insiders indicate this new installment will leverage the Switch 2’s improved graphical capabilities to deliver a visually stunning and action-packed space combat experience.

Beyond 2024: A Pipeline of Blockbuster Titles

Nintendo’s ambitions extend far beyond the initial launch window. Leaked plans reveal a robust pipeline of upcoming titles, including The Duskbloods, Splatoon Raiders, and Pikmin 4, all targeted for a 2026 release. Instant Gaming News details these upcoming projects, showcasing Nintendo’s commitment to delivering a diverse and compelling lineup of games.

However, fans of the 3D Mario series may face a longer wait. Current projections suggest a new 3D Mario title isn’t expected to arrive until 2027. This extended development cycle likely reflects Nintendo’s desire to create a truly groundbreaking and innovative experience that pushes the boundaries of the Switch 2’s capabilities.
